当前位置: 首页 > article >正文

【vue】npm install 报错 python2 Error: not found: python2

如图所示,vue项目在下载依赖的时候报错找不到python2,有网友通过下载python2.7并配置环境变量解决了,这里有两个其他自测可用的方式,供各位作为参考。

报错的主要原因是因为【sass-loader】【node-sass】这两个依赖跟nodejs版本有关。

1.从已经成功下载依赖的项目里把这两个依赖复制过来,把自己项目中这两个依赖删除,替换为复制过来的依赖,再执行npm install,则执行成功。

2.变更nodejs版本,版本不能太高,测试使用17、19、20的都不成功,使用14.21.3版本的nodejs下载成功了。


http://www.kler.cn/a/445092.html

相关文章:

  • 爱思唯尔word模板
  • 【畅购商城】校验用户名、手机号以及前置技术Redis和阿里大鱼短信验证码
  • 第三方接口设计注意要点
  • Boost之log日志使用
  • 如何在 Ubuntu 22.04 上使用 systemctl 管理 systemd 服务教程
  • STM32F103RCT6学习之四:定时器
  • Day27 C++ 动态内存
  • ArcGIS Pro 3.4新功能3:空间统计新特性,基于森林和增强分类与回归,过滤空间自相关
  • CTFHUB 历年真题 afr-1
  • 如何编辑调试gradle,打印日志
  • upload-labs靶场
  • uniapp小程序抽奖怎么做?直接使用【almost-lottery转盘组件】或者【自定义宫格转盘】
  • SL4008B升降压芯片 9-36V降12V/2A 耐压40V 外置MOS管 80W大功率IC
  • 自动化运维平台的选型指南:开源与商业化工具对比
  • TypeScript 与前端框架React
  • 解决git报错:fatal: unable to connect to cache daemon: Unknown error
  • 小白投资理财 - 看懂 SAR 抛物线转向指标
  • qt学习之用qlabel制作假表格
  • Java项目常见基础问题汇总(2)
  • docker(wsl)命令 帮助文档
  • 编程训练系统(代码+数据库+LW)
  • 《全面解析 QT 各版本:特性、应用与选择策略》
  • 二百八十、ClickHouse——用Kettle对DWD层补全的清洗数据进行记录
  • 【真人模型】Stable Diffusion:人脸特美的人像摄影大模型
  • MySQL批量删除字段跑路?
  • Ubuntu 22.04永久保存路由